Unveiling the Magic: Venaseal Treatment for Varicose Veins Explained
Venaseal represents a significant advancement in the treatment of varicose veins, marking a departure from traditional, more invasive methods. This innovative approach to varicose vein treatment utilizes a medical adhesive to close off varicose veins, which not only simplifies the process but also minimizes the discomfort often associated with vein removal procedures.
